Does MacPorts have a version of rm that does secure removal of
files (that is, scribbling over the disk so that info cannot be
recovered)? I want this for files about my bank dealings---I'm not
referring to files that come from MacPorts downloads.
Does MacPorts have a version of rm that (unlike Unix, but like Mac
Os X) is undoable?

David there is a rm replacement that mv's the files to the Trash
instead of deleting them. You could then use the Mac OS "empty trash
-- secure".
Is that what you want?
